On the "Standard Ticket Header" widget on the Employee Center, you can configure the fields which are visible, using Standard Ticket > Standard Ticket Configuration.

What I am after, is adding the Watch List. This is also shown in the Docs example (under number 6, Watch List is shown).

When adding Watch List though, no go, "The following fields 'Watch list' are not allowed in info region
" 😞 I will dig into the error to see if can find anything that way. Though another Docs page also actually mentioned that some fields can not be added.

Though... how was the Docs example then made? How did they add Watch List up there?

In HRSD, the Watch List field can be added to the Standard Ticket info region in the HR Service record (Opened for / Approver view, Subject person/ Task assignee view fields, how to article here https://incident.do/2023/11/29/servicenow-hrsd-adding-the-watch-list-to-the-standard-ticket-configur...).  In the screenshot from the docs above, it looks like this is a universal request in the context of HRSD.  Adding it from the Standard Ticket Configuration record (in ITSM for example) seems to be a whole different thing.
